Common Spiders Extermination Questions
What types of spiders are commonly targeted in extermination services? Services typically address common household spiders such as cobweb spiders, cellar spiders, and orb-weavers to reduce infestations indoors and around the property.
Are spider extermination treatments safe for pets and children? Treatments are designed to minimize risks to residents, but it’s recommended to follow safety instructions and keep pets and children away from treated areas until safe.
How can property owners prevent future spider problems? Regular cleaning, reducing clutter, sealing cracks, and removing webs can help prevent spiders from establishing new hiding spots around the property.
What signs indicate a spider infestation in a property? Visible webs, spider sightings, and egg sacs are common signs of an ongoing or potential infestation requiring professional treatment.
